Abstract
A method of repairing a nuclear power facility metal component assembly with a "Class A" fastening between hard metal parts (12,14) includes several steps they are: PA0 providing aligned openings (20,22) in a plurality of hard metal parts (12,14) to be assembled; PA0 EDM machining a non-cylindrically shaped cavity (16) which is analogous to a counterbore having a cavity opening (24) smaller than the cavity base (18); PA0 inserting a locking collar (10) with a central aperture (32) and surrounding flange (3) to receive a bolt head (42) and with weakened zones of deformation (34) through the cavity opening (24); PA0 inserting a headed and threaded bolt (40) through the central aperture (32) of the locking collar (10) and into the aligned bores (20,22); PA0 providing threads (46a) in another of the hard metal parts to mate the bolt threads (46); PA0 torquing the bolt (40) in the provided mating threads (46a) to draw the bolt head (42) toward the cavity base (18) and deforming the locking collar at its weakened zones of deformation (34) to cause it to expand to an overall dimension which prevents its passage out of the cavity opening (24); and, PA0 deforming the flange (30) to interfer…
